• Home
  • History
  • Annotate
  • Raw
  • Download
  • only in /netgear-R7000-V1.0.7.12_1.2.5/ap/gpl/samba-3.0.25b/source/nsswitch/

Lines Matching refs:username

48 static struct WINBINDD_CCACHE_ENTRY *get_ccache_by_username(const char *username)
53 if (strequal(entry->username, username)) {
93 DEBUGADD(10,("event called for: %s, %s\n", entry->ccname, entry->username));
199 DEBUGADD(10,("event called for: %s, %s\n", entry->ccname, entry->username));
274 BOOL ccache_entry_exists(const char *username)
276 struct WINBINDD_CCACHE_ENTRY *entry = get_ccache_by_username(username);
284 BOOL ccache_entry_identical(const char *username, uid_t uid, const char *ccname)
286 struct WINBINDD_CCACHE_ENTRY *entry = get_ccache_by_username(username);
308 const char *username,
318 if ((username == NULL && princ_name == NULL) || ccname == NULL || uid < 0) {
328 entry = get_ccache_by_username(username);
331 if (!ccache_entry_identical(username, uid, ccname)) {
336 username, entry->ref_count));
349 if (username) {
350 entry->username = talloc_strdup(entry, username);
351 if (!entry->username) {
412 DEBUG(10,("add_ccache_to_list: added ccache [%s] for user [%s] to the list\n", ccname, username));
426 NTSTATUS remove_ccache(const char *username)
428 struct WINBINDD_CCACHE_ENTRY *entry = get_ccache_by_username(username);
440 username, entry->ref_count));
448 username, entry->ref_count ));
468 entry->ccname, username));
474 DEBUG(10,("remove_ccache: removed ccache for user %s\n", username));
489 struct WINBINDD_MEMORY_CREDS *find_memory_creds_by_name(const char *username)
494 if (strequal(p->username, username)) {
606 static NTSTATUS winbindd_add_memory_creds_internal(const char *username, uid_t uid, const char *pass)
613 struct WINBINDD_MEMORY_CREDS *memcredp = find_memory_creds_by_name(username);
617 username ));
626 (unsigned int)uid, username, (unsigned int)memcredp->uid ));
631 username, memcredp->ref_count ));
639 memcredp->username = talloc_strdup(memcredp, username);
640 if (!memcredp->username) {
656 username ));
664 struct WINBINDD_CCACHE_ENTRY for this username with a
669 NTSTATUS winbindd_add_memory_creds(const char *username, uid_t uid, const char *pass)
671 struct WINBINDD_CCACHE_ENTRY *entry = get_ccache_by_username(username);
674 status = winbindd_add_memory_creds_internal(username, uid, pass);
680 struct WINBINDD_MEMORY_CREDS *memcredp = find_memory_creds_by_name(username);
693 NTSTATUS winbindd_delete_memory_creds(const char *username)
695 struct WINBINDD_MEMORY_CREDS *memcredp = find_memory_creds_by_name(username);
696 struct WINBINDD_CCACHE_ENTRY *entry = get_ccache_by_username(username);
701 username ));
707 username, memcredp->ref_count));
717 username));
720 username, memcredp->ref_count));
733 NTSTATUS winbindd_replace_memory_creds(const char *username, const char *pass)
735 struct WINBINDD_MEMORY_CREDS *memcredp = find_memory_creds_by_name(username);
739 username ));
744 username ));